Bolas de Tamarindo (Tamarind Sweet Balls)

Ingredients
 

  • 20 fresh tamarind pods or 1 14 oz block of tamarind pulp
  • ½ cup of sugar

Instructions
 

  • Remove the tamarind fruit from its shell, devein and break into small pieces. Add to a bowl and mix with 6 tablespoons of sugar, then mold into small balls.
  • Place the rest of the sugar in a small bowl. Place the tamarind balls in the mixture and roll around until all of the balls are coated. You can eat them immediately or keep refrigerated in a container for a couple of days.
